- [ ] Step 7: Archive cold storage buckets (Glacierline tier). Confirm both ceremony witnesses are present, verify bucket manifests match the Oxbow ledger, then seal the archive key shares. Plugin authors may observe but not handle shares. Once sealed, the archive index itself is encrypted and can only be reopened with the passphrase below.

vault phrase of badup-hahig = tamael-aldael-kelmir-istael-fenok-istwyn-tamius-jorath-oliion

**Ticket: Signature check failing on gateway callbacks**

Plugins hitting the Mossbridge internal gateway above 40 req/min get throttled, and the 429 responses are returned unsigned, so client-side verification fails hard instead of backing off. Fix ships in gateway 1.9: throttle responses are now signed. Update your verifier to the rotated key that follows.

deploy key for kajof-fajop: bky6_gDHw9Q

## Deploying the Gatewick Proctor Queue

Deploys are pretty painless: push to main, wait for the pipeline, then watch the queue drain dashboard for five minutes. If candidates pile up mid-exam, roll back first and ask questions later — the queue replays safely. Everything the workers care about lives in one config block, shown here for reference.

settings of bafof-yagef:
JOROX_PIN=8740
JOROX_TENANT=pelox
JOROX_METRICS_HOST=metrics.jorox.qorvelworks.internal
JOROX_SEAL=seal_c78f63c1
JOROX_STANDBY_TEAM=norax

**Off-site run — item 7: calibration weights.** Batch KV-19 from Merrowfield Metrology, twelve weights, foam-cased, gross 14 kg. Case stays upright; no stacking, no re-packing en route. Driver signs the tamper strip log at the Dalforth gate before departure and again on arrival at the Quensby lab dock. No stops between sites. Temperature is not critical, but keep the case out of direct sun. Confirm seal numbers match the manifest before release. The hand-over instruction for the courier follows below.

courier memo of yawep-yafog: the pramir ulaix courier leaves the ulavan aldix frair zorok oliiel joreth rusdor fenvan ledger at gate 1305 under passcode 514738